Bay Area and inland fans who plan to attend Stockton Con 2017 are in for a special treat as it has been confirmed that Alan Oppenheimer will be a guest.
Alan Oppenheimer is actor with a very impressive resume as he has played many iconic characters in film, TV and video games. Has been pioneer in both live action TV and animated features.
In film, Oppenheimer is best known for his role as Dr. Contrare in Gammera and the Supervisor in Westworld and TV fans will recognize him for his role as General Duncton on Knight Rider and Declan Keogh on Star Trek: Deep Space Nine. Cartoon fans will best know him for his role as Skeletor, Man-At-Arms along with Mer-Man from He-Man and the Masters of the Universe, the titular hero in Mighty Mouse and Alfred Pennyworth in Batman: The Animated Series. Gamers will also know him for his role as Harold in the Fallout series.
Joining Oppenheimer will be Diane Pershing (the voice of Poison Ivy in the DC Animated Universe), Timothy D. Rose (best known for his role as Admiral Ackbar in Star Wars), wrestling icon Ric Flair, Walter Jones (the first Black Ranger in Power Rangers) and comic artist Katie Cook just to name a few. More guests and news will be announced in the months leading up to StocktonCon 2017.
StocktonCon 2017 is a fan convention that will take place at the Stockton Arena from August 19 until the 20th. Tickets are on sale online now or at selected retailers.
